
Singapore’s Private Home Prices Climb to Record on Sales
(Bloomberg, 2 Jan) - Singapore home prices climbed to a record in the fourth quarter after developers sold more homes, a government report showed. The island state’s private residential property price index rose 1.8 percent to 211.90 points in the three months ended Dec. 31, according to preliminary estimates released by...
